**Key Ceremony Checklist — Item 4: Tile Cache Signing**

Support team: before signing keys for the Mapforge tile-rendering cache layer are rotated, verify the cache is drained and the warmer jobs are paused. Confirm both custodians are present and the ceremony log is open. Once verified, authenticate to the custodian console with the recovery passphrase noted immediately below:

unlock words, hahip-baduf: holwyn-istath-julvan

## Pagination Limits and Quotas

The Quillbrook public API enforces cursor-based pagination on all list endpoints. Page sizes above the hard cap are rejected with a 400 rather than silently truncated, so release notes must flag any cap changes to partners. Quota counters reset hourly per token, not per account. Before tagging a release, verify the constants below match the gateway config.

tuning table, yajog-yahof:
BUDGETS = {
    "lamvan": 303,
    "wenox": 460,
    "fenvan": 525,
}

Subject: Reseller programme update — Lanterow Systems

Team,

The Lanterow reseller programme completes its pilot this month across the Westholm branches. Sign-up volumes exceeded forecast by roughly 18%, though margin per unit remains below target. We will standardise onboarding materials and tighten discount approvals before the full rollout. Branch managers should hold off on new reseller commitments until revised terms are issued. Details of the rollout strategy follow in the note below.

management briefing: Project Ulavan slips by two quarters because of the staffing delay.